How to convert SPOTIFY to MP3
Spotify streams music using a proprietary encrypted format that is designed to prevent downloading. Songs on Spotify are DRM-protected, meaning they cannot legally be extracted or converted to MP3 using any tool. BoltConverter does not support bypassing Spotify's DRM or downloading copyrighted music from Spotify.
If you want MP3 versions of music for offline use, legal options include purchasing tracks from music stores (iTunes, Amazon Music, Bandcamp), using royalty-free music services, or downloading music that has been licensed for free distribution. For your own recordings, you can export them from your recording software as MP3 directly.

Frequently asked questions
Can BoltConverter download or convert Spotify music?
No. Spotify audio is DRM-protected and encrypted. BoltConverter does not support bypassing DRM protection. Any tool claiming to freely convert Spotify streams is either illegal, non-functional, or a scam.
Is it legal to convert Spotify music to MP3?
No. Spotify's terms of service prohibit downloading or copying music from the platform. Even if a tool could technically do it, distributing or using DRM-circumvention tools for commercial music is illegal under laws like the DMCA in the US and equivalent laws in most countries.
What if I want MP3s to listen offline?
Spotify Premium subscribers can download songs within the Spotify app for offline listening (but they stay encrypted). For actual MP3 files, purchase songs from stores like iTunes, Amazon Music, or Bandcamp, which sell DRM-free downloads.
Can I convert my own podcast from Spotify?
If you host a podcast on Spotify for Podcasters (Anchor), you can download your own episode audio files directly from your creator dashboard in their original format.
